WATCH - Flintoff gets asked if he's a cricket fan; later surprises the guy with his IPL details

Andrew Flintoff was signed by the Chennai Super Kings for a whopping INR 7.55 crores in 2009.

Andrew Flintoff stunned a fan who had no idea the former England all-rounder was a cricketer. The video in which Flintoff had a conversation with a fan is going viral on social media.

Hosting a TV show, Top Gear, Flintoff and the fan were sitting inside a car when they talked about cricket. The guy asked the ex-cricketer if he is a cricket fan or not and later questioned about IPL.

The Englishman must not be very familiar with such questions as he was among the popular players during his playing days. When Flintoff revealed he has played IPL for Chennai Super Kings (CSK), the fan was shocked.

"Are you a fan of cricket?" asked the fan, to which Flintoff replied, "Yes". The fan further asked if he watches IPL and which team he supports, and Flintoff responded with "Chennai Super Kings". 

The guy was delighted as he was also a Super Kings fan, but the funny moment came when Flintoff revealed he was part of the franchise. "Really, what year? Well, I was a baby at that time so I didn't watch cricket," said the cricket fan who was in disbelief on the Englishman's big reveal.

Flintoff was the highest-paid overseas player when he got bought by CSK INR 7.55 crore.
